I have a Fromeco Ion Cube (I purchased one with the brain and filled 3 of the 5 slots if you are familiar with the Cube) that I will be using to charge 3 2600 Fromeco Lithium Ion packs that I recently purchased. I have a marine battery installed in a Haulmark trailer that is wired to 2 110 volt outlets. My question is.....do I really need a power supply if I plan to normally do my charging in the trailer when I am at home? Or would it be better for some reason if I get a power supply to charge at home?

I am planning on charging at the field using a battery jump box for convenience if I need to.

Also, one other thing is that I normally have my trailer plugged into a wall outlet so my marine battery stays fully charged.

No, you won't need a power supply at all. You've got a good set-up with 12 volt battery and a way to keep it charged.
